As innovation accelerates, Herz P1 Tracker units are shrinking, sensors are getting extra subtle, and prices are coming down. In the meantime, activity trackers are converging with medical devices, giving rise to prescription wearables. Climbing steadily for Herz P1 Tracker years, the pandemic boosted wearable adoption. Based on a Deloitte survey, 14% of US smartwatch house owners bought their device after the onset of COVID-19. Step counting aside, 11% of consumers use their smartwatch to detect COVID-19 symptoms. As client demand cools, market intelligence platform IDC said gadget makers must differentiate, opening the door for brand spanking new hardware and software program offerings. Based in 2013, Oura’s sleep-monitoring smart ring put the finger-worn form issue on the map. Ramping up, this spring, the company surpassed 1M items bought and raised new capital, notching a $2.55B valuation. However, the model hit a couple of stumbling blocks alongside the way. Oura introduced its Gen 3 ring final year.



Irritating users, the company additionally instated a monthly subscription, effectively paywalling the app. In the meantime, provide chain issues brought about delivery delays. Months on, Gen three house owners are nonetheless ready for the device’s promised features to launch. In the interim, Oura was compelled to increase free entry as upgrades lagged. Amid the fallout, Harpreet Singh Rai exited the CEO spot in December 2021. COO Michael Chapp filled the interim function until former SurveyMonkey president Tom Hale was hired this April. Sensing an opening, wearable makers are wanting beyond the wrist. Circular. After opening US pre-orders in February, this French smart ring brand hopes to deliver merchandise this summer. Like different gadgets, Circular measures coronary heart charge variability (HRV), blood oxygenation (SPO2), breathing fee, body temperature, and extra. Promising simple-to-understand data and a worth tag that’s $50 lower than Oura, the brand is focusing on more casual health seekers. A purple flag, in Might, Oura sued Circular for infringing on two of its patents, looking for to dam all US sales while collecting restitution for lost revenue.



"We embrace creativity and innovation in well being technology, including from our rivals… Movano. Whereas Oura tries to guard its patents, healthtech company Movano is strengthening its IP portfolio. Founded in 2018, Movano is ready to launch its flagship product, a smart ring designed for girls, later this 12 months. Along with the Movano Ring, the corporate develops noninvasive sensors, including proprietary tech for glucose and blood stress monitoring. Like the broader trade, Movano is merging wellness and medical wearables. As it pursues FDA approval, the corporate is assembling a shopper-focused crew, together with former Hydrow CMO Tyla Bucher and Google/Fitbit strategic partnership head Stacy Salvi. Elsewhere. Talking of Fitbit, the corporate filed a patent for an SPO2 and blood strain-sensing ring in 2021. And metabolic well being firm Ultrahuman acquired Indian smart ring maker LazyCo this April. Because the ring wars heat up, wearables nonetheless should prove their value - from growing activity to bettering health outcomes, there’s little evidence to support their effectiveness. But, as know-how improves and prices fall, all indicators level to more well being sensors, not less. With that, the smart ring isn’t the end sport - it’s a pit cease on the street to all the time-on health tracking.
